Bruce Croxon is a prominent Canadian entrepreneur, venture capitalist, and television figure known for his significant contributions to the tech and investment sectors. As a partner at Round13 Capital, he plays a vital role in supporting and nurturing innovative startups. Croxon gained widespread recognition as a co-host on BNN's acclaimed program, The Disruptors, where he showcases disruptive business ideas and trends.

Croxon's entrepreneurial journey began with the founding of Lavalife, a pioneering dating website that transformed the way people connect romantically online. His success with Lavalife not only established him as a leader in the tech industry but also laid the groundwork for his future ventures.

From 2011 to 2013, Croxon was a key member of the cast on CBC's Dragons' Den, where he evaluated aspiring entrepreneurs' pitches and invested in promising business ideas. His experience on the show further solidified his reputation as a savvy investor and mentor in the startup ecosystem.

With a blend of entrepreneurial spirit and investment acumen, Bruce Croxon continues to influence the Canadian business landscape, inspiring the next generation of innovators through his work and media presence.
